A year or two ago, I had hardly visited anywhere in Parkersburg. Now, I'm quickly making my way through all of the restaurants.
The Corner Cafe has a cool entrance that echos the car motif it's just across the lot from.
The menu has standard sandwiches, dinner specials and salads.
I went for a West Virginia cheesesteak with sauteed green peppers, onions, mushrooms, steak, and provolone cheese. They were out of hoagie buns but put it on texas toaste for me.
They served one to me, which ended up being someone else's order, but then once I got mine, I dug in. Tasty!
